Why Bathroom Paint Peels, and What Actually Holds in a Santa Monica Wet Room

The most common call we get in Santa Monica goes something like this. The bathroom was painted a year or two ago, it looked great, and now the ceiling above the shower is lifting and there is grey speckle creeping along the top of the tile. The caller usually blames the paint, or the last painter, or occasionally themselves for buying the cheaper option.

Nine times out of ten, none of those is the real culprit. Bathroom and kitchen paint fails for reasons that are physical and predictable, and once you can tell the two main failure modes apart you can work out whether you are buying a paint job or something else entirely. This is the explanation we end up giving on doorsteps two or three times a week, written down.

Two Failures That Look Similar and Are Not

Stand in front of the damage and ask one question: is the paint coming off in sheets, or is it discolored and speckled while still stuck down?

Peeling in sheets is a water-from-behind problem. Something got between the paint film and the surface underneath it. Either the surface was damp, dusty or greasy when it was coated and the paint never really bonded, or vapor is condensing behind the film and lifting it. When you pull a strip off, look at the back of it. If it brings a thin layer of the old surface with it, the failure is in the substrate. If it comes off clean, like a sticker, it never bonded in the first place.

Grey and black speckle that is still firmly attached is mildew. That is a living growth on and in the film, feeding on the binder and on whatever soap film and body oil is sitting on the surface. It thrives on damp, poorly ventilated, low-airflow surfaces, which describes a shower ceiling exactly.

They call for different responses. The first is a preparation and often a ventilation problem. The second is a cleaning problem, followed by a coating problem. Treating one as if it were the other is how people end up repainting the same room three times.

The Uncomfortable Truth About Extraction

Before we talk about products at all, we look at the fan. A large share of bathroom paint failures in this city are not coating failures. They are ventilation failures that a coating got blamed for.

Here is what we find, in rough order of frequency.

The duct vents into the attic. Someone fitted a fan and ran flexible duct up through the ceiling, and it simply stops in the attic space or points vaguely at a soffit. All that fan does is move your shower steam from a room you can see into a space you cannot, where it condenses on the underside of the roof deck and on the back of your bathroom ceiling. That ceiling then stays damp from both sides.

The fan is undersized. Extraction is rated by air volume, and a unit intended for a small powder room fitted in a room with a soaking tub and a big shower enclosure will run all day without clearing the air.

The fan is wired to the light. The room clears its steam in the ten to twenty minutes after you finish showering, which is exactly the period when the light is off and everyone has gone to work. A timer or a humidity-sensing switch fixes this for less than the cost of repainting the ceiling.

There is no fan and the window is painted shut. Common in the older apartment stock here and in bungalows that have been repainted many times over.

None of that is a painter’s usual scope of work, and we are not going to rewire your bathroom. But we will trace where the duct goes and tell you what we find, because if moisture cannot leave that room then no coating on the market will survive in it, and we would rather lose the job than sell you a repeat of it.

What the Marine Layer Does to a Wet Room

Santa Monica adds its own layer to this. Ocean fog rolls in and the outdoor air sits close to saturation for hours at a time. Windows are open in summer, the ambient humidity inside the house rises with it, and a bathroom that was already borderline never gets a proper drying cycle.

There is a working rule in the trade about dew point. A surface needs to be a few degrees above the dew point while a coat forms its film, five degrees is the common figure, or the film does not form properly and stays soft. On a foggy morning an unheated north-facing bathroom in a 1920s building can be sitting right at that margin. Push a coat onto it anyway and you get a finish that looks acceptable when you leave and never fully hardens, which then fails early and looks like a product fault.

This is why we sometimes tell people we will start after lunch, or that a two-coat bathroom is not going to be finished in one overcast day. It is not padding the schedule. It is the difference between a coating that cures and one that just dries.

Salt spray matters too, on the exterior side. If the bathroom backs onto a stucco elevation facing the water, salt deposits on that wall hold moisture and defeat adhesion out there. Washing it down is part of the job on the west side of a building in a way it simply is not further inland.

Where Prep Time Actually Goes

Assume the ventilation is sound or is being fixed. Here is where the hours in a proper wet-room repaint land, and it is not on rolling.

Cleaning, and more cleaning. Bathroom surfaces carry soap film and body oils. Kitchen surfaces carry an aerosolized layer of cooking grease that extends well past the range hood, because a recirculating hood over a gas burner just moves that air around the room. Both are invisible and both stop paint bonding. We degrease, rinse with clean water, and let it dry. If you want to test your own kitchen wall, press a strip of masking tape firmly onto it and pull. If it lifts without resistance, there is a film on that wall.

Killing the mildew. A biocidal wash, worked in, left to dwell, then rinsed and dried fully. Painting over live growth feeds it, and it comes back through the new coat as speckle within a season. This is the single most common corner cut in a cheap bathroom quote.

Cutting out what has gone soft. Press on the drywall at the tub edge and around the shower valve. If it gives, the board has taken on water and it is not a paint substrate any more. It gets cut back to sound material and replaced with a moisture-resistant panel. Skimming compound over a soft area produces a repair that fails on exactly the same schedule as the last one.

Caulk, in the right places. Joints that move get a flexible sealant, tooled and given time to skin before anything covers it. Joints that do not move get filler. The joint between a tub and a tiled wall is a plumbing seal and not a decorative one, and paint should never be relied on to bridge it.

Priming for the actual substrate. Bonding primer over old gloss. Stain blocker over water rings, rust weeping from a fixing and tannin bleeding from old redwood trim. Masonry primer on alkaline surfaces. These are not interchangeable, and an extra coat of finish paint substitutes for none of them.

Then, Finally, the Coating

A moisture-resistant paint is a tighter, harder, less porous film than standard wall paint, usually carrying a mildewcide. On a clean, dry, properly prepared and adequately ventilated surface it holds years longer than a flat wall finish. That is a real benefit and it is worth paying for.

What it is not is waterproofing. It will not hold back water arriving from behind, and it will not compensate for a fan that vents into an attic. Sold honestly, it is the last ten percent of a job whose first ninety percent was preparation and airflow.

Sheen is the other decision. Higher sheen means a harder, tighter film that sheds water and takes cleaning, so semi-gloss is the durable answer in a bathroom. The catch is that shine shows every ripple, patch and old lap mark, and a lot of the plaster walls in the Ocean Park and Sunset Park bungalows are genuinely wavy. In those rooms satin usually looks far better and still performs well. Ceilings over a shower are the one place we push back on flat paint, because flat is porous and that ceiling is the wettest surface in the house.

Elastomeric coatings come up often when the exterior stucco is involved. They bridge hairline cracks and they are excellent at that. They are also thick and relatively closed to vapor, so on a wall that needs to dry outward they trap moisture and blister. Right product, wrong wall, is a real and expensive mistake.

What We Would Tell You at the Door

If the ceiling is peeling in sheets, budget for the cause as well as the surface. If it is speckled, it is cleanable and the repaint will hold. If the fan vents into the attic, spend the money there first and repaint next season with confidence. If you live in an older building, ask about lead-safe practice before anyone puts a sander on a wall, because the paint layers in a lot of pre-1978 housing here warrant testing rather than assumption.

And if a quote for a bathroom looks suspiciously cheap, ask what it includes for washing, mildew treatment and priming. That is where the difference lives, and it is the part you cannot see once the room is finished.
